✦ Synopsis
The X-ray scattering intensities of liquid water observed by Narten and Levy have been reanalyzed, especially in the region 7-16 A-' of the scattering parameter. The intensities in this region are accounted for as an interference pattern due to the OH...0 hydrogen bond with anharmonicity. The Morse anharmonicity parameter is estimated to be 1.9 f 0.8 A-', which is nearly equal to those observed for ordinary chemical bonds. The distance and the root-mean-square amplitude are determined as 2.91 kO.02 A and 0.17 k 0.01 k respectively.
